ToridAkbolto 170 July 30, 2012 Share July 30, 2012 Consciously note what you are doing. Note why you are doing what you are doing and for how long. When the intent seems trivial (when you "want to") and the result seems harmful (skipping class to post on forums), that is when obsession becomes unhealthy. If you must ask yourself whether or not this action is harmful, assume it is. You will know if it is innocuous. 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
